Abstract

A modular fence system includes a plurality of modular fence assemblies. Each fence assembly includes a first post connected to a side of a panel section and a second post connected to an opposing side of the panel section. The posts and panels are adjustable to varying heights and are attachable to one another in a plurality of varied angular orientations.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A modular fence system comprising:
 a plurality of modular fencing assemblies, each modular fencing assembly comprising a first post connected to first side of a panel section and a second post connected to a second side of the panel section, each of the first and second posts including an upper head containing a plurality of spaced openings extending through a height of the upper head; and   a fastener having a first downward prong and a second downward prong connected by a connecting portion, the first downward prong inserted into one of the plurality of spaced openings of one of the first or second posts of one of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ies and the second downward prong inserted into one of the plurality of spaced openings of one of the first or second posts of a second one of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ies to connect the one and the second one of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ies in a continuous configuration.   
     
     
         2 . The modular fence system of  claim 1 , wherein each of the spaced openings of the upper head of the one of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ies enables connection of the one of the plurality modular fencing assemblies with the fastener in a different angled orientation, relative to the second one of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ies. 
     
     
         3 . The modular fence system of  claim 2 , wherein the angled orientation comprise an acute angle orientation, an obtuse angle orientation, a 90 degree angle orientation or a 180 degree orientation. 
     
     
         4 . The modular fence system of  claim 3 , wherein the plurality of spaced openings are equidistantly spaced about the upper head. 
     
     
         5 . The modular fence system of  claim 2 , wherein the panel section of each of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ies is distinct from the panel section of each of the other of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ies. 
     
     
         6 . The modular fence system of  claim 2 , wherein the panel section of each of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ies is continuous with the panel section of each of the other of the plurality of module fencing assemblies. 
     
     
         7 . The modular fence system of  claim 2 , wherein each of the first and second posts includes a ground-penetrating stake. 
     
     
         8 . The modular fencing system of  claim 7 , wherein each of the first and second posts includes a ground anchor coupled to the ground-penetrating stake. 
     
     
         9 . The modular fencing system of  claim 8 , wherein the ground anchor presents a foot-placement upper surface. 
     
     
         10 . The modular fencing system of  claim 9 , wherein the ground anchor minimizes rotational movement of the post. 
     
     
         11 . The modular fencing system of  claim 1 , further comprising a panel connector connecting the panel section to at least one of the first and second post. 
     
     
         12 . The modular fence system according to  claim 7 , wherein the panel connector comprises a first loop that engages the at least one of the first and second post and a second loop that engages the panel section, the first loop connected to the second loop by first and second side lengths. 
     
     
         13 . The modular fence system according to  claim 1 , wherein the panel section is rolled about the first and second posts in an uninstalled configuration and wherein the panel section is extended between the first and second posts in an installed configuration. 
     
     
         14 . A modular fence system comprising:
 a plurality of modular fencing assemblies, wherein each of the plurality of modular fencing assemblies includes:   a first post and a second post, each of the first and second post having a central channel housing an interior height-adjusting post, wherein the interior height-adjusting post is secured to its respective post at one of a plurality of selectable heights;   a panel section extending between the first post and the second post including at least one cross component having first and second ends, each of the first and second ends including a horizontal portion that is perpendicular to each of the first and second post; and   a first post receptacle secured to the first post and a second post receptacle secured to the second post at one of a plurality of selectable heights, wherein the first and second post receptacles receive, respectively, the horizontal portion of the first and second ends of the cross component to connect to the panel section to the first and second post.   
     
     
         15 . The modular fence system of  claim 14 , wherein the panel section includes a vertical component that is perpendicular to the horizontal portion of the cross component and wherein the vertical component includes a height-adjusting interior component that is secured to vertical component at one of a plurality of selectable heights. 
     
     
         16 . The modular fence system of  claim 14 , wherein each of the first and second post receptacles includes a base and three sides extending from the base in the same direction. 
     
     
         17 . The modular fence system of  claim 16 , wherein each of the first and second receptacles includes a hinged top portion to engage at least two of the three sides, the engaged top portion retaining the first and second ends, respectively, of the cross component. 
     
     
         18 . The modular fence system of  claim 16 , wherein at least one of the three sides of each of the first and second receptacles is secured, respectively, to the horizontal portion of the first and second ends of the cross component of the panel section. 
     
     
         19 . The modular fence system of  claim 14 , a first post and a second post, each of the first and second post having central channel housing an interior height-adjusting post, wherein the interior height-adjusting post of the first post is secured to the first post at a first height and wherein the interior height adjusting post of the second post is secured to the second post at a second height that is different from the first height. 
     
     
         20 . The modular fence system of  claim 15 , wherein the panel section includes a plurality of vertical components, wherein the height-adjusting interior vertical component of a first one of the plurality of vertical component is adjusted to a first height and wherein the height-adjusting interior vertical component of a second one of the plurality of vertical component is adjusted to a second height that is different from the first height.
